#a9a2e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a9a2e4 is composed of 66.3% red, 63.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 28.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 246.4 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 76.5%. #a9a2e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5345c9.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#a9a2e4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a9a2e4 has RGB values of R:169, G:162,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11117284.

Hex triplet a9a2e4 #a9a2e4
RGB Decimal 169, 162, 228 rgb(169,162,228)
RGB Percent 66.3, 63.5, 89.4 rgb(66.3%,63.5%,89.4%)
CMYK 26, 29, 0, 11
HSL 246.4°, 55, 76.5 hsl(246.4,55%,76.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 246.4°, 28.9, 89.4
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 69.382, 16.654, -32.363
XYZ 43.284, 39.877, 78.811
xyY 0.267, 0.246, 39.877
CIE-LCH 69.382, 36.396, 297.231
CIE-LUV 69.382, -0.558, -53.681
Hunter-Lab 63.148, 11.84, -29.793
Binary 10101001, 10100010, 11100100

Shades and Tints of #a9a2e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05040d is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.
